Key Features to Hunt Down
- Transparent processing times – no vague “up to 48 hours” fluff.
- Dedicated support channels for finance queries.
- Clear KYC steps, preferably pre‑filled from your registration data.
- Multiple withdrawal methods that actually move money, not just crypto tokens that require an extra conversion.

Practical Checklist for the Savvy Player
- Check the average withdrawal time listed on the site – if it says “usually 24 hours”, be prepared for the occasional 48‑hour outlier.
- Verify that your preferred payment method is supported for both deposits and withdrawals.
- Read the fine print on verification – some sites only ask for a utility bill after the first withdrawal, which can add days.
- Test the speed with a small deposit before committing larger sums.
